Output 239344041660a5b494c7e2fed0a42507db56f60b1e12402a40f607f61fcea0e5:0

value
166710
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 50c8d3a198c7189d547f19a8304836343c25332a OP_EQUALVERIFY OP_CHECKSIG
address
18N9e2gtVCG2dS6RaVBpBszakKdvqEtJQ6
transaction
239344041660a5b494c7e2fed0a42507db56f60b1e12402a40f607f61fcea0e5
spent
true